About G Bardazzi
G Bardazzi is a scholar working on Pharmacology, Genetics, Epidemiology, Infectious Diseases and Gastroenterology, having authored 17 papers that have together received 479 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Inflammatory Bowel Disease (12 papers), Microscopic Colitis (9 papers), Pharmacological Effects of Natural Compounds (4 papers), Tuberculosis Research and Epidemiology (3 papers), Eosinophilic Esophagitis (3 papers),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ment (2 papers), Substance Abuse Treatment and Outcomes (2 papers) and Alcohol Consumption and Health Effects (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Genetics (364 citations), Epidemiology (353 citations), Gastroenterology (40 citations), Hepatology (50 citations) and Surgery (159 citations). G Bardazzi has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, United States and Guatemala. Frequent co-authors include Giacomo Trallori, G d'Albasio, Andrea Messori, F. Pacini, Andrea Amorosi, Andrea Bonanomi, Mónica Milla, Domenico Palli, Clarissa Belloli and N. Martini. Their work appears in journals such as Alcoholism Clinical and Experimental Research, Gastroenterology, Journal of Clinical Gastroenterology, Alcohol and Alcoholism and European Journal of Public Health.
